"Audre Lorde was an American writer, feminist, womanist, librarian, and civil rights activist. She was a self-described "black, lesbian, mother, warrior, poet," who "dedicated both her life and her creative talent to confronting and addressing injustices of racism, sexism, classism, and homophobia."- Wikipedia

Audre uses allusion, imagery and figurative language to create a calm and peaceful scene. She addresses the listener who will come to her and to whom she will speak to lightly and silently. It suggests how communication with the person is not an easy task.
